Overview
The Township of Warwick offers up to $3,000 to help homeowners reduce sewage backup risks. It supports sump pump disconnection and backwater valve installation work completed in eligible homes.

Activities funded
- Disconnecting sump pumps from the sanitary sewer.
- Installing an inside backwater valve.
Documents Needed
- Signed application form.
- Signed waiver form.
- Customer survey.
- Detailed contractor invoice.
- Written proof that weeping tile is not connected to the sanitary sewer, if applicable.
Eligibility
Who is eligible?
- Homeowners in the Township of Warwick.
- Residents in high-risk areas.
Who is not eligible
- Properties served by septic systems.
Eligible expenses
- Backwater valve installation.
- Sump pump disconnection work.
- Related permit fees.
Ineligible Costs and Activities
- Work on homes served by septic systems.
- Projects that do not meet the program conditions.
Eligible geographic areas
- Township of Warwick, Ontario.
Processing and Agreement
- Applications are reviewed by the Township on a case-by-case basis.
- Applications may be accepted or rejected at the Township’s discretion.
- Reimbursement is made after approved documents are reviewed and the work is confirmed complete.
- A cheque is mailed within 4 to 6 weeks after a complete and acceptable application is received.
Additional information
- The program is offered by the Township of Warwick.
- Applications are reviewed case by case.
- Preference is given to homes in high-risk areas with a history of wastewater backups.
- The grant is one-time only.
